Between sips of local wine at Kristall Kellerei Winery, discover ancient rock paintings at Phillips Cave that tell stories of early inhabitants. Immerse yourself in traditional culture at the Living Museum of the San, where demonstrations of hunting techniques and crafts bring heritage to life.

Best time to go to Omaruru

The best time to visit Omaruru can depend on the weather and when visitor numbers rise and fall. The hottest average temperature in Omaruru falls in November, when visitor numbers are average and weather is sunny with no rain. The coolest average temperature in Omaruru falls in June and July. July has average visitor numbers and sunny weather.

calendar iconCalendar Monthtemperature iconTemperaturerain iconPrecipitationmostly cloudy iconCloudinessoccupation rate iconOccupancyprice iconPricing
January75.7°F (24.3°C)Light RainSunnyAverageAverage
February74.7°F (23.7°C)Light RainMostly SunnyAverageSlightly High
March73.4°F (23.0°C)Light RainSunnySlightly HighSlightly Low
April71.2°F (21.8°C)No RainSunnySlightly HighAverage
May67.5°F (19.7°C)No RainSunnyAverageAverage
June61.3°F (16.3°C)No RainSunnySlightly LowAverage
July61.3°F (16.3°C)No RainSunnyAverageSlightly Low
August66.2°F (19.0°C)No RainSunnyAverageSlightly High
September72.7°F (22.6°C)No RainSunnySlightly HighSlightly Low
October76.3°F (24.6°C)No RainSunnySlightly LowSlightly High
November77.0°F (25.0°C)No RainSunnyAverageAverage
December76.8°F (24.9°C)Light RainSunnySlightly LowAverage

The nearest major airports for your trip to Omaruru

Accessing Omaruru in Namibia is convenient via two major airports in Windhoek. Hosea Kutako International Airport (WDH) is situated 196km away, with excellent accommodation options nearby such as the 5-star Zannier Omaanda Lodge, located 5km from the airport, offering a free 24-hour airport shuttle. Another option is Naankuse Lodge, a 3-star establishment 16km from WDH, also providing easy airport access. Alternatively, Eros Airport (ERS) is 175km from Omaruru, with nearby hotels like the Hilton Windhoek and Weinberg Windhoek, both just 3km away and offering various transportation services to the airport.

What's the weather like in Omaruru?
The hottest months are usually October and November with an average temp of 76°F, while the coldest months are July and June with an average of 64°F. Average annual precipitation for Omaruru is 18 inches.
